Rick's Story
After leaving Casa, I went to Berkeley for a while, making the baseball team as a walk on, but later got a scholarship due to the influence of a local Yankee scout. Being only 17 and hoping to get drafted, I dropped out of Cal, immediately hurt my arm and decided to drink my woes away at Chico State. Great school, but the social aspects were rough on the brain cells.
Not knowing what to do, I got into the financial business. I worked with a few firms and became the state senior underwriter for the California operations of the bank in Los Angeles. That gig was supposed to be 6 months long, but I ended up staying for 15 years. When Wells Fargo took us over, I went out on my own into mortgage brokering.
